The AI Arms Race in Game Development: Can Smaller Studios Compete?
The gaming industry is bracing for a seismic shift. Hyung-tae Kim, CEO of South Korean studio Shift Up (creators of Stellar Blade and Goddess of Victory: Nikke), recently argued that embracing Artificial Intelligence isn’t just an option for countries like South Korea – it’s a necessity for survival in the face of industry giants like China and the United States. His comments, made at South Korea’s 2026 Economic Growth Strategy event, highlight a growing anxiety: how can smaller development teams compete with sheer manpower?
The Manpower Gap: A Stark Reality
The numbers are staggering. Kim pointed out that Shift Up typically dedicates around 150 people to a single game project. In contrast, Chinese studios routinely deploy teams ranging from 1,000 to 2,000 developers. This disparity isn’t unique to game development; it reflects a broader trend across tech industries. This isn’t simply about having more bodies; it’s about the capacity to produce content at scale. According to a recent report by Newzoo, the global games market is projected to generate $184 billion in revenue in 2024, and China currently holds the largest share.
This scale allows Chinese developers to iterate faster, explore more ideas, and ultimately, release a higher volume of games. South Korea, and other nations with smaller development pools, are facing a critical challenge: how to level the playing field.
AI as a Force Multiplier: One Developer, 100 People?
Kim’s solution? AI. He believes that generative AI tools have the potential to dramatically increase developer productivity. His provocative claim – that a single, AI-trained developer could perform the work of 100 – underscores the transformative potential of the technology. This isn’t about replacing developers, he clarified, but about augmenting their abilities. Shift Up has already been experimenting with AI to explore creative concepts, as noted in a clarification following concerns about concept artist roles (GamesIndustry.biz).
The core idea is to automate repetitive tasks, accelerate prototyping, and empower developers to focus on higher-level creative problem-solving. Imagine AI handling initial asset creation, level design blocking, or even basic code generation, freeing up human developers to refine, polish, and innovate.
Beyond Gaming: AI’s Impact on Creative Industries
This trend extends far beyond gaming. The film, animation, and music industries are all grappling with the implications of AI. Companies like RunwayML and Pika Labs are democratizing access to powerful AI video generation tools, allowing creators to produce high-quality content with significantly reduced budgets and timelines. Adobe’s Firefly suite integrates generative AI directly into its Creative Cloud applications, offering features like text-to-image generation and content-aware fill.
However, the integration isn’t without its hurdles. Concerns around copyright, artistic integrity, and the potential displacement of creative professionals remain significant. The recent Writers Guild of America (WGA) strike, partially fueled by concerns about AI’s impact on screenwriting, demonstrates the anxieties within the creative community.

The Skills Gap: Investing in AI Training
Kim emphasized the importance of training developers in AI technologies. He argues that developers who can effectively leverage AI tools will become significantly more valuable. This highlights a critical need for investment in education and reskilling programs. Governments and industry organizations need to proactively equip the workforce with the skills necessary to thrive in an AI-driven future.
Several universities and online learning platforms, such as Coursera and Udacity, are already offering courses in AI and machine learning. However, more specialized training programs tailored to the specific needs of creative industries are needed.
